iccvid: Make decode_cinepak a bit more consistent and easier to read (resend)

Bruno Jesus 00cpxxx at gmail.com
Sat Oct 17 07:54:45 CDT 2015


Signed-off-by: Bruno Jesus <00cpxxx at gmail.com>

Just some variable renaming and a struct for the header to make its
components grouped.
